What are the safe operation instructions for the XTOOL PRODIGY?

For safe operation of the XTOOL PRODIGY, please follow the instructions below:

• Keep the device away from heat or fumes when in use.

• If the vehicle battery contains acid, please keep your hands and skin or fire sources away from the battery during testing.

• The exhaust gas of the vehicle contains harmful chemicals. Please ensure adequate ventilation.

• Do not touch the vehicle cooling system components or exhaust manifolds when the engine is running due to the high temperatures reached.

• Make sure the car is securely parked, Neutral is selected or the selector is at the P or N position to prevent the vehicle from moving when the engine starts.

• Make sure the (DLC) Diagnostic Link Connector is functioning properly before starting the test to avoid damage to the Diagnostic Computer.

• Do not switch off the power or unplug the connectors during testing.

• Doing so may damage the ECU (Electronic Control Unit) and/or the Diagnostic Computer.


What are the cautions for handling the XTOOL PRODIGY?

• Avoid shaking, dropping or dismantling the scan tool as it may damage the internal components.

• Use only your fingertips to touch the LCD screen. Hard or sharp objects may damage the scan tool.

• Do not use excessive force.

• Do not expose the screen to strong sunlight for a long period.

• Please keep the scan tool away from water and moisture.

• Store and use the scan tool only within the temperature ranges identified in the Technical Specifications section.

• Keep the unit away from strong magnetic fields.

How do I connect the XTOOL PRODIGY to a vehicle wirelessly?

Step 1. Press and hold the Power button to turn on the tablet.

Step 2. Select the App language and start the activation, following the hints to complete it.

Step 3. Connect the DB15 connector of the main cable to the VCI box.

Step 4. Plug the OBDII-16 connector of the main cable into the vehicle’s DLC port.

Step 5. When the VCI box gets powered on, the tablet will automatically search for it and make a WiFi connection.

Step 6. Your tablet is now ready for diagnosis.


How do I connect the XTOOL PRODIGY to a vehicle with a wired connection?

To establish a wired connection, you connect the main cable from the vehicle’s DLC port to the VCI box, and then connect the VCI box to the tablet via a USB cable. For models with DoIP protocol communication, you must connect the device to the vehicle by wire.


What precautions should I take before running diagnostics with the XTOOL PRODIGY?

1. The voltage range on the car must be +9~+36V DC.

2. When testing special functions, operate according to the prompts and meet test conditions. For some models, this means the engine water temperature should be 80 °C~105 °C, headlights and air conditioners should be off, and the accelerator pedal should be in the released position.

3. If a test is impossible or data is abnormal, you can search for the vehicle’s ECU and select the menu for the model on the ECU nameplate.

4. If the vehicle type or electronic control system is not found, please upgrade the vehicle diagnostic software to the latest version.

5. Only use wiring harnesses provided by XTOOL to avoid damage to the vehicle or the device.

6. When running a Diagnostics function, do not shut down the device directly. You must cancel the task before returning to the main interface to shut down the device.


How do I select a vehicle for diagnosis on the XTOOL PRODIGY?

The XTOOL PRODIGY supports 3 ways to access the smart diagnostics system:

• **AUTO SCAN:** Supports automatic reading of the vehicle VIN code. Tap the “AUTO SCAN” button on the diagnosis system entrance. Ensure the car and device are well connected.

• **MANUAL INPUT:** Supports manual input of the 17-character car VIN code. Ensure the characters entered are correct for accurate results.

• **SELECT VEHICLE BY AREA:** Choose a car brand by selecting the appropriate region (e.g., Europe, America, Asia) at the top of the screen and then select the vehicle model.


What should I do if my vehicle model is not recognized by the AUTO SCAN function on the XTOOL PRODIGY?

If your model is not recognized by AUTO SCAN, please try the following steps:

Step 1. UPDATE all software, and check whether the APP is updated in [Settings].

Step 2. Click Diagnosis on the main menu to enter the selection menu, manually select the engine system to read the ECU information, and confirm whether the VIN can be read.

Step 3. Contact the XTOOL technical team to provide the VIN code to confirm whether the model supports automatic identification of VIN.

How can I view and customize live data on the XTOOL PRODIGY?

The “Read Live Data” function shows real-time information from various vehicle sensors. You can use this data to identify potential problems. The XTOOL PRODIGY provides several ways to view this data:

• **Search:** Click the magnifying glass on the top right to search for specific PIDs (parameter identifications) based on keywords.

• **Custom:** Select and show multiple PIDs at once. Click “Display All” to see all available PIDs.

• **Combine:** Select multiple PIDs and click “Combine” to merge their graphs into a single chart for comparison.

• **Data recording:** The scan tool can record current data values as text. You can view these recorded files in Reports > Data Replay.

• **Pause:** Click the pause button to pause the recording timeline.


What is the Actuation Test (Bi-directional control) on the XTOOL PRODIGY?

Actuation test, also known as bidirectional control, is a function that allows the XTOOL PRODIGY to send commands to and receive information from a vehicle’s control modules. It is primarily used to determine if specific actuating components of the engine, such as relays, injectors, and coils, are functioning correctly. The scan tool can request information (like data parameters) or command a module to perform specific tests and functions. This helps in checking individual parts to see what is working properly without having to physically remove them.


How do I perform an ABS Bleeding procedure with the XTOOL PRODIGY?

When the ABS contains air, the ABS bleeding function must be performed to restore brake sensitivity. Follow these steps:

Step 1. Read the on-screen operating instructions and precautions carefully before starting.

Step 2. Attach a bleeder bottle to the left rear bleeder screw.

Step 3. Open the left rear bleeder screw.

Step 4. When ready, click “OK” on the XTOOL PRODIGY to enter the bleed procedure. Begin pumping the brake pedal continuously with steady applies every 2 seconds throughout the entire procedure.

Step 5. Continue pumping the brake pedal. When air bubbles are no longer visible, select “OK” to proceed to the next wheel.

Step 6. Repeat the operation for the left front wheel, right front wheel, and right rear wheel in turn.

Step 7. After the final wheel, stop pumping the brake pedal and close the right rear bleeder screw.

Step 8. Click “OK” to complete the entire bleed procedure.

**Caution:** The ABS pump screw needs to be unscrewed. Brake fluid will be under pressure; secure the bleed hose and open bleeder screws slowly. Some vehicles may require manual bleeding.


How do I perform an Oil Reset with the XTOOL PRODIGY?

The Oil Reset function resets the engine oil life system. The procedure is as follows:

Step 1. Enter the Oil Reset menu and select the relevant model for the vehicle being tested.

Step 2. Follow the specific on-screen instructions for your vehicle and press OK after completing them. This may involve turning the ignition on with the engine off.

Step 3. Enter the Maintenance mileage reset menu.

Step 4. Click INPUT and enter a reasonable value for the remaining oil life (e.g., 100 for 100%) and press OK.

Step 5. Confirm the new value you entered and click OK at the bottom right to complete the procedure.

Step 6. A ‘Write successfully’ message will be displayed when the Oil Reset is complete.


How do I use the EPB (Electronic Parking Brake) function on the XTOOL PRODIGY?

The EPB function is used to maintain the electronic brake system, including deactivating/activating the brake control system, assisting with brake fluid control, and setting brakes after disc or pad replacement.

Step 1. Enter the EPB menu and choose the relevant model for the vehicle being tested.

Step 2. Follow the on-screen instructions, such as turning the ignition to ON and releasing the handbrake. Press YES to continue.

Step 3. Enter the ‘Enter maintenance mode’ menu, release the handbrake, and press OK.

Step 4. Wait for the ‘Successful operation’ message to appear, then press OK to exit the menu.

Step 5. Enter the ‘Exit maintenance mode’ menu and wait for the ‘Successful operation’ message to appear.


How do I perform a SAS (Steering Angle Sensor) calibration with the XTOOL PRODIGY?

SAS calibration permanently stores the current steering wheel position as the straight-ahead position. Before calibration, the front wheels and steering wheel must be set exactly to the straight-ahead position.

Step 1. Enter the SAS menu and choose the relevant model for the vehicle being tested.

Step 2. Enter the ‘Set steering angle sensor’ menu and follow the on-screen instructions, such as turning the ignition switch ON.

Step 3. Wait for the next instruction, which may ask you to confirm the vehicle is on level ground and the steering wheel is in the neutral position. Press Yes to continue.

Step 4. Follow further instructions, such as rotating the steering wheel left and right and then returning it to the middle position. Press OK.

Step 5. Wait for the final instruction, then press OK to complete the procedure.

A ‘Function execution is completed’ message will display when the SAS reset is successful.


How do I perform a BMS (Battery Management System) Reset with the XTOOL PRODIGY?

A BMS reset is performed after replacing the main battery to clear original low battery fault information and match the new battery.

Step 1. Enter the BMS Reset menu and choose the relevant model for the vehicle being tested.

Step 2. Turn on the ignition switch.

Step 3. Press OK to continue the BMS function.

Step 4. Enter the new battery’s capacity (e.g., in Ah) within the given range and press OK.

Step 5. Enter the battery manufacturer and press OK.

Step 6. Enter the 10-digit battery serial number and press OK after the input.


How do I perform Injector Coding with the XTOOL PRODIGY?

This function writes the identification code of a new fuel injector into the ECU. It is necessary after the ECU or injector is replaced.

Step 1. Enter the Injector coding menu and choose the relevant chassis model.

Step 2. Enter the ‘Fuel injection nozzle injection volume adjustment’ menu.

Step 3. Read the on-screen note carefully and press OK.

Step 4. Read and confirm the current values stored for the cylinders.

Step 5. Enter the ‘Change the value of cylinder’ menu for the replaced injector(s). Enter the new 5-digit value printed on the new injector and press OK.

Step 6. Wait for the ‘Write successfully’ message to pop up.

Step 7. Turn off the ignition switch, then wait for the prompt to turn it back on.

Step 8. Re-enter the ‘Fuel injection nozzle injection volume adjustment’ menu to verify that the new value(s) have been saved correctly.


How do I perform a DPF Regeneration with the XTOOL PRODIGY?

DPF regeneration is used to clear Particulate Matter (PM) from the DPF filter. This is a detailed procedure that requires careful attention to on-screen instructions.

Step 1. Enter the DPF menu and choose the relevant model.

Step 2. Enter the DPF regeneration menu.

Step 3. Carefully read and complete all listed requisites before starting. This may include ensuring the fuel tank is at least 1/4 full, the transmission is in Park or Neutral, and the parking brake is applied. Press OK.

Step 4. Read the fuel tank level and carbon deposit load to ensure they meet requirements.

Step 5. Choose the “drive to warm up” option if available and follow the instructions to start the engine and let it idle. Press OK.

Step 6. Read the subsequent instructions carefully. These will warn of high exhaust temperatures and the need for a safe, open space. Press OK.

Step 7. Follow the prompts to let the engine idle and prepare for regeneration. The device may instruct you to bring the engine speed to a specific RPM (e.g., 1500rpm). Press OK.

Step 8. Press the OK button to start the regeneration process.

Step 9. Wait for the process to complete. The value of the carbon deposit will decrease. This process can take up to 40 minutes. An ‘Emergency regeneration has been completed’ message will appear.

Step 10. Wait for 2 minutes to let the particulate filter cool down.

Step 11. Press ‘drop out’ to exit the DPF function.


How do I perform a TPMS Reset on the XTOOL PRODIGY?

The XTOOL PRODIGY supports TPMS learning, matching, and resetting functions. The exact procedure depends on the vehicle’s system (Automatic Relearn, Static Relearn, OBD Relearn, or Copy ID Relearn). Note that the XTOOL PRODIGY provides the Reset/Relearn function but not the activation of TPMS sensors; a separate TPMS activation tool may be needed.

AUTOMATIC RELEARN

1. Install tire pressure sensors appropriately.

2. Adjust all TPMS sensors to the standard pressure value.

3. Keep the vehicle at a complete standstill with the engine and power off for more than 20 minutes.

4. Drive at 30-100km/h for more than 15 minutes.

5. The vehicle will automatically relearn the value, and the tire pressure warning light will disappear.

STATIC RELEARN

1. Install all tire pressure sensors appropriately.

2. Pull up the parking brake.

3. Turn the ignition to ON/RUN with the engine off.

4. Enter the tire pressure learning mode through the vehicle’s instrument panel.

5. Starting from the left front wheel, use a TPMS Activation Tool to activate the sensor. The vehicle will confirm with a horn or turn signal flash.

6. Activate the remaining sensors in the order of right front, right rear, and left rear.

7. Turn the vehicle off and adjust all sensors to the standard pressure value.


How do I use the XTOOL PRODIGY VCI Box as a J2534 Pass-Thru device?

The VCI Box can be used as a Pass-Thru device to perform diagnostics or reprogram vehicle modules using OEM software on a PC.

Step 1. Ensure your PC has the necessary OEM software and the XTool J2534 Toolbox installed.

Step 2. Connect the VCI Box to your PC via the USB-B to USB-C cable (use a USB adapter if needed).

Step 3. Connect the VCI Box to the OBD port of the vehicle using the Main Cable.

Step 4. You can now use the OEM software on your PC to communicate with the vehicle through the VCI Box.

Note: XTool does not provide any OEM diagnostic or re-flash applications. You must get the corresponding software from the vehicle manufacturer.


How do I view, save, and print diagnostic reports on the XTOOL PRODIGY?

The Report function provides a history of diagnostic reports.

• **Saving a Report:** When you finish a diagnostic session and exit the application for that vehicle, you will be prompted to save a report. You can enter details like Vehicle Name, Year, VIN, and Mileage.

• **Viewing a Report:** Go to the main ‘Report’ menu to see a list of all saved diagnostic reports. Click on a report to open and view it.

• **Printing a Report:**

Step 1. Install a third-party printing APP on the tablet that can connect to your target printer.

Step 2. On the Android main menu, go to Settings -> Printing and turn your printer on.

Step 3. Open the desired report from the Report menu.

Step 4. Click “Print PDF Report” at the bottom right corner.

Step 5. Click the top-left corner of the screen to choose the printer you previously added, then click the button on the right to print.


How do I update the software on the XTOOL PRODIGY?

After activating the device, you should update the software. All software updates are delivered directly via the Internet.

Step 1. Open the Diagnostic application.

Step 2. Click on ‘Updates’ to enter the update screen.

Step 3. The device will identify all currently available software packages.

Step 4. You can download them individually or click ‘Update All’ to download all available updates.

Note: When your subscription expires, the installed software will still be available, but you will not receive any new updates.


How do I perform a Factory Reset on the XTOOL PRODIGY?

A factory reset erases all custom settings and data, returning the device to its original state.

Step 1. From the main home page, enter the ‘Settings’ mode.

Step 2. Click on “Backup & reset”.

Step 3. Follow the onscreen prompts to initiate the factory reset process.

Once the reset is complete, the scan tool will restart, and you will need to select the language and connect to Wi-Fi again.


How do I get remote assistance for my XTOOL PRODIGY?

The XTOOL PRODIGY uses the TeamViewer QuickSupport program for remote assistance. Ensure the tablet is connected to the Internet before starting.

Step 1. Turn on the power of the tablet.

Step 2. Click ‘Remote’ in the Diagnostic application. The TeamViewer screen will display, and a unique device ID will be generated.

Step 3. Your support partner must have the full version of the TeamViewer program installed on their computer.

Step 4. Provide your device ID to the partner or XTOOL technician.

Step 5. Wait for them to send a remote-control request. A pop-up window will appear on your device.

Step 6. Click ‘Allow’ to accept the remote control session, or ‘Reject’ to decline it.


What do the different DTC (Diagnostic Trouble Code) statuses mean on the XTOOL PRODIGY?

DTC Status Descriptions Suggestions
Current/Present Current DTC’s are trouble codes that are stored in the ECU when both continuous and non-continuous (2 trip) monitors fail. Current DTC’s command the MIL On the instant they are stored in the ECU. Current DTC’s can be cleared using the Clear DTC’s function of the Scantool, or when the ECU monitor (2 trip monitor) has ran and completed 40 consecutive trips without a fault.
History/Stored History DTC’s are trouble codes stored in the ECU when continuous and non-continuous monitors (2nd trip) fail. History DTC’s set in conjunction with Current DTC’s and are not cleared by the ECU monitor. History DTC’s can only be cleared using the Clear DTC function of the Scantool. Pending Pending codes are codes that prep themselves when they determine a fault that engine cycle. They are basically a preliminary investigation for your engine. To simplify, a random malfunction can occur during the current drive cycle but only happen for a split second. This will cause the malfunction to throw a “pending code”. Typically pending codes are not to severe but you shouldn’t ignore them either, it can be cleared using the Clear DTC’s function of the Scantool
Permanent Permanent DTC’s are trouble codes that are stored in the ECU when continuous and non-continuous monitors fail. Permanent DTC’s are set in conjunction with Current and History DTC’s. Permanent DTC’s cannot be cleared using the Clear DTC’s function on the Scantool. Instead, Permanent DTC’s are cleared when the ECU monitor completes and passes three consecutive trips.
For Volkswagen
Active/static Active/Static means that the fault is happening at the moment and can/should be take care of. The fault cannot be cleared directly by using the Clear DTC’s function of the diagnostic tool and the internal fault of the car must be eliminated manually
Passive/sporadic It is a fault that has occurred in the past and can be cleared by Scantool, and user should to check if the DTC will appear again. /
